INSTALLATION
Notes: Choose the mounting location where the unit will not interfere with the normal driving function of the driver.
· Before finally installing the unit, connect the wiring temporarily and make sure it is all connected up properly and the unit and the system work properly.
· Use only the parts included with the unit to ensure proper installation. The use of unauthorized parts can cause malfunctions.
· Consult with your nearest dealer if installation requires the drilling of holes or other modifications of the vehicle.
· Install the unit where it does not get in the driver's way and cannot injure the passenger if there is an emergency stop.
· If installation angel exceeds 30°from horizontal, the unit might not give its optimum performance.
· Avoid installing the unit where it would be subject to high temperature, such as from direct sunlight, or from hot air, from the heater, or where it would be subject to dust, dirt or excessive vibration.

ATTENTIONS OF INSTALLATION 1.This player should be installed by professional technician. 2. please read the instruction and operation of equipment carefully before installing. 3. Make sure to connect other wires before power connection. 4. To avoid short circuit. Please make sure all the exposed wire are insulating. 5. Please fix all the wires after installation. 6. Please make connection to the player accordingly to this instruction manual.
Wrong connection may cause damage. 7. This player only fit for 12V DC device and please make sure your car belongs to this kind of
cathode grounding electrical system. 8. Please connect the wires rightly. Wrong connection will cause malfunction or damage the
electrical system.

OPERATION
Turn ON/OFF the unit and mute function Press /MUTE button to turn ON the unit. When the unit is on, shortly press this button for mute on/off. Press and hold this button to turn off the unit.
Audio & Setting Adjustment Shortly press SEL button and rotate VOL knob to show below: ZONE A->ZONE B->ZONE C. To select one of them and press SEL and rotate VOL to enter below items: BAS (-7~+7)->TRE (-7~+7)->BAL (R7~L7)->EQ (POP-ROCK-CLASS-JAZZ-OFF) ->LOUD (off/on)->P-VOL (00-40) In each item, press SEL and rotating the VOL knob to set them.
Press and hold SEL button and rotate VOL into the SETTING menu as below: CT (indep/sync)->CLOCK (12/24)->BEEP (off/on)->AREA (USA/EUR)->DX (LOC) ->STEREO (MONO) In each item, press SEL and rotating the VOL knob to set them. When shows menu, press the DISP button to exit the menu.
P_VOL Setting Setting the power on volume. If the volume at shutdown is small than the P-VOL. Next time turning on the unit, the volume will be maintained at shutdown volume. If the volume at shutdown is greater than the P-VOL. Next time turning on the unit the volume will be restored to the P-VOL value.
CT (INDEP/SYNC) CT INDEP: The clock works independently. It doesn't be synchronized to the RDS station's time. CT SYNC: The clock will be synchronized to the received RDS station's time. Note: When the time was set by manual. The CT will go back to INDEP mode automatically. CLOCK 24/12: Setting the time to 24H or 12H format. BEEP (ON/OFF): Turn on/off the beep sound.
AREA (USA/EUR): To choose USA or EUROPE frequency.
DX/LOC (Distance/Local): LOC: Receive the strong signal station only in seek station. DX: Receive strong and weak signal station in seek the station.
STEREO/MONO: STEREO: Receive FM stereo signal. MONO: Change FM stereo to monochrome. It can reduce the noise when the signal is weak.
Dimmer Function Press DIM button to set the brightness to high/low.

ALARM Operation Press and hold ALARM button to set the alarm time (using VOL knob to set them). Shortly press ALARM button to on/off alarm function. When alarm function is ON. The time is running to the alarm time. The speaker will output beep sound. The beep sound will output all the time until any key was pressed.
SLEEP Operation Press and hold SLEEP button to set the sleep time (using VOL knob to set them). Shortly press SLEEP button to on/off sleep function. When sleep function is on and the time is running to the set time. The unit will turn off the unit automatically.
Information/Clock display Shortly press DISP button to show the clock or information.
Clock Setting Press and hold DISP button for 2 seconds. The "HH" will be flashing. Rotate VOL knob to set the hour. After that press DISP or SEL button the "MM" will be flashing. Rotate VOL knob to set the minute. Then press DISP or SEL button to confirm.
Speakers Output Control The three speaker output buttons (SPEAKER A/B/C) control speaker output. Press any of the three buttons to turn up or down the corresponding speaker output.
RCA/HDMI Output Behind the head unit, there are RCA sockets output. According the wiring picture above to connect. When playing the video file. You also use the HDMI port connect to the TV set (TV set needs to be set to HDMI source).
AUX IN/AV IN Function AUX IN for front panel 3.5mm jack. AV IN for RCAs (Audio + Video) behind of the unit. Press MODE button switch to AUX IN/AV IN source.
ARC Function Connecting the head unit and TV set used a HDMI cable. Press MODE button switch to HDMI ARC mode. The TV set's sound will transmit to the head unit's speakers.
MCU Reset When some errors occur in display or functions doesn't work. Press RESET button (24) to reset the MCU. Then press POWER button to turn ON the unit.
DATA Reset Press MODE button switch to AUX IN source. Press and hold " " button for 5 seconds. It will restore all data to factory settings. (Note: All memories will be lost.)
RADIO OPERATION Receiving a radio station Press MODE button to select radio source. Then press BAND button to select a band. Shortly press / button to receive the desired radio station. Press and hold / button for manual tuning the frequency.

Auto Store Station Press and hold BAND button for 2 seconds to auto store stations to numeric buttons 1-6 of band 1~3.
Manually store station & recall preset station To receive a station with or button. Press and hold one of the 1- 6 preset button for 2 seconds. The current station is stored into the number button. Shortly press the preset button (1~6) to directly listen the station that saved in the corresponding preset button.
In WEATHER BAND 1 button: 162.400 MHz 2 button: 162.425 MHz 3 button: 162.450 MHz 4 button: 162.475 MHz 5 button: 162.500 MHz 6 button: 162.525 MHz
The next station is 162.550 MHz. Press / button to change these stations.
DISC/MP3/WMA Operation Switch to DISC Source Gently insert the DISC with the printed side uppermost into disc slot. DISC playback begins. Or press MODE button switch to DISC source.
SELECTING TRACKS Press / button move to the previous / next track. Hold / button to fast reverse or fast forward. Press " " button to play again.
Pause/Play Operation Press button to pause playing. Press it again to resume play.
Intro Operation Press INT button to play first 10 seconds of each track. Press it again to cancel this function.
Repeat One/All Operation Press RPT button to repeat the same track. Press it again to repeat all tracks.
Random ON/OFF Operation Press RDM button to play all tracks in random order. Press again to cancel this function.
Eject the disc: Press button to eject the disc.
DIR+/DIR- Function (for MP3/WMA) Press DIR-/DIR+ button to select previous/next directory to play.
+10/-10 File Function (for MP3/WMA) Press and hold DIR+/DIR- button for 2 seconds to skip +10/-10 file to play.

Search Song Operation Press BAND button to select song search mode: DIR SCH or NUM SCH
1. DIR SCH: Press BAND button one time. It shows "DIR SCH". Rotating VOL knob to select the folder then press SEL knob into the folder. Rotate the VOL knob again to select the song. Then press SEL to play.
2. NUM SCH: Press BAND button twice. It shows "NUM SCH". You can select the song by directly enter numeric buttons: 0~9 (MODE=7, =8, =9, DISP=0). You also can rotate the VOL knob to select the numeric. Then press SEL to play.
Video/Photo/Music Playing Change When there are Video/Photo/Music files in the disc/USB. Insert the disc/USB to the unit, it will play the music automatically. Repeatedly Press and hold BAND button to change to below playing: Music-->Video-->Photo
CAUTION: 1. When connecting an MP3 player that has normal battery (non rechargeable battery), you
should remove the battery first from the MP3 player then connect it to the USB interface. Otherwise, it may cause battery burst. 2. When there are important files in the DISC/USB/SD, do not connect it to the main unit to play. Our company assumes no responsibility for any important files that loss or damaged.

WIRELESS BT STREAMING OPERATION PAIRING Select the Wireless BT item and search the BT device on your phone. Select "PyleUSA" and input password "0000" if it needs a password. The BT icon will be displayed when successful paired.

10 www.PyleUSA.com

Wireless BT Audio (A2DP function) Press MODE button switch to "BT MUSIC" source. It will play a song of your mobile phone automatically. Press key to pause/play the song. Press / button to select next/ previous song.
Disconnect the Wireless BT After the phone is paired with the unit. Hold MODE key to disconnect/re-connect BT. Note: At the first time pair with mobile phone, you have to use mobile phone to pair the unit. BT OFF/ON item only to disconnect and reconnect function.
DISC NOTES A. Notes on discs: Attempting to use non-standard shape discs (e.g. square, start, heart) may 1. Damage the unit. Be sure to use round shape CD discs only for this unit. 2. Do not stick paper or tape, etc, into the label side or the recording side of any discs, as it
may cause a malfunction. 3. Dirt, dust, scratches and warping discs will cause misoperation.
B. Notes on CD-Rs (recordable CDs)/CD-RWs (rewritable CDs): 1. Be sure to use discs with following marks only for the unit to play:
ReWritable
2. The unit cannot play a CD-R and CD-RW that is not finalized. (Please refer to the manual of your CD-R/CD-RW recorder or CD-R/CD-RW software for more information on finalization process).
3. Depending on the recording status, conditions of the disc and equipment used for the recording, some CD-Rs/CD-RWs may not be played on this unit. (see *1) *1: To have more reliable play back, please see following recommendations: a. Use CD-RWs with speed 1x to 4x and write with speed 1x to 2x. b. Use CD-Rs with speed 1x to 8x and write with speed 1x to 2x. c. Do not play a CD-RW which has been written for more than 5 times.
C. Notes on MP3 files (MP3 Version Only): 1. The disc must be in the ISO9660 level 1 or level 2 format, or Joliet or Romeo in the
expansion format. 2. When naming MP3 file, be sure the file name extension is ".MP3". 3. For a non-MP3 file, even though the file name extension is ".MP3", the unit will not
recognize it.
